From: Ingo Molnar Date: Fri, 11 Apr 2025 05:40:15 +0000 (+0200) Subject: x86/alternatives: Rename 'struct bp_patching_desc' to 'struct text_poke_int3_vec' X-Git-Url: https://www.infradead.org/git/?a=commitdiff_plain;h=84e5ba949b0a3fcf2fd0a1b6c9ce14d8436dbbb8;p=users%2Fdwmw2%2Flinux.git x86/alternatives: Rename 'struct bp_patching_desc' to 'struct text_poke_int3_vec' Follow the INT3 text-poking nomenclature, and also adopt the 'vector' name for the entire object, instead of the rather opaque 'descriptor' naming. Signed-off-by: Ingo Molnar Cc: Juergen Gross Cc: "H . Peter Anvin" Cc: Linus Torvalds Cc: Peter Zijlstra Link: https://lore.kernel.org/r/20250411054105.2341982-4-mingo@kernel.org --- diff --git a/arch/x86/kernel/alternative.c b/arch/x86/kernel/alternative.c index 5f448142aa993..8edf7d3fd1840 100644 --- a/arch/x86/kernel/alternative.c +++ b/arch/x86/kernel/alternative.c @@ -2471,17 +2471,17 @@ struct text_poke_loc { u8 old; }; -struct bp_patching_desc { +struct text_poke_int3_vec { struct text_poke_loc *vec; int nr_entries; }; static DEFINE_PER_CPU(atomic_t, bp_refs); -static struct bp_patching_desc bp_desc; +static struct text_poke_int3_vec bp_desc; static __always_inline -struct bp_patching_desc *try_get_desc(void) +struct text_poke_int3_vec *try_get_desc(void) { atomic_t *refs = this_cpu_ptr(&bp_refs); @@ -2517,7 +2517,7 @@ static __always_inline int patch_cmp(const void *key, const void *elt) noinstr int poke_int3_handler(struct pt_regs *regs) { - struct bp_patching_desc *desc; + struct text_poke_int3_vec *desc; struct text_poke_loc *tp; int ret = 0; void *ip;